Michael E. Stutcavage, 46, of Menlo Park Terrace, Woodbridge died Sunday July 18, 2010, at JFK Medical Center Haven Hospice in Edison. Born May 13, 1964 in Newark, he lived in Menlo Park all his life.
Michael graduated from St. Joseph High School, Class of 1982, and attended Rutgers University. He was a self-employed financial consultant.
He was predeceased by his father, Edward M. Stutcavage, in 1980. He is survived by his mother Rosemarie (Reo) Stutcavage with whom he resided; his brothers, Robert M. Stutcavage of Scotch Plains and Scott C. Stutcavage of Menlo Park Terrace; his niece, Crystal, to whom Michael was godfather, and nephew Edward.
